IP查询
查询
你查询的IP:[121.4.127.47] 地理位置:中国–上海–上海
最新查询
117.59.118.15
121.48.212.80
118.24.138.55
59.64.88.216
122.119.181.36
59.32.127.34
117.58.55.67
120.128.114.122
202.93.225.227
121.4.127.47
211.144.63.178
202.130.0.64
121.89.76.242
58.87.64.232
203.223.156.105
58.240.194.45
58.30.35.32
58.14.112.232
123.199.128.166
116.194.39.164
202.46.32.255
202.127.208.133
125.214.96.54
203.191.16.234
122.156.30.234
121.8.143.121
121.52.208.248
220.242.72.24
61.29.128.116
121.4.89.89
118.228.170.253